Brakes

If your loved one is in need of more stability and balance to avoid falling A seat-based rollator is an excellent alternative. As opposed to standard walkers that require more strength in the upper body to lift, a rollator can be controlled with the pressing of a button or lever. This means that people who are unable to move will experience less fatigue and exhaustion.

Rollators come in different sizes and braking options, allowing you to find the ideal model to meet your particular needs. Smaller wheels (6" or 7") have a tighter turn radius and are perfect for maneuvering in narrow spaces. Larger wheels (8" or more) provide a smoother riding experience on uneven outdoor terrain.

A lot of rollators have foot and hand brakes, which gives you the choice of the one that is most comfortable for you. Hand brakes can be operated by squeezing the lever, while foot brakes require you to press down on the pedal. Both kinds of brakes are effective but hand brakes are more user-friendly.

The seat on a rollator provides you with a place to sit whenever you want to take to take a break from walking. It also helps prevent further injury and strain. Your walker's chair will likely be padded to provide maximum comfort. However, some people prefer seats without padding because of the additional security and security they offer.

Once you've found the right walker for you, it's important to know how to operate and adjust it properly. The first step is adjusting the height of the handle. To do this, make your loved one stand up straight and measure the distance between their hips and the ground with an instrument. Once you have the measurement you can pull the handle up to adjust the Walker.

The next step is adjusting the angle of the handles to the best position for your hand. This can be accomplished by grasping the handle with your hands and pulling them firmly apart, or you can loosen the screw on the rear of each grip and turn or turn it until you are in the desired position.

The wheels of rollators can be made of polyurethane or rubber and can be molded according to the model. The size of the wheels could affect the way that the rollator is operated and handled. Smaller wheels can be used indoors for maneuvering in tight spaces. Larger wheels (8") are ideal for outdoor use, since they can handle more difficult terrain. Certain models also come with non-marring soft gripping casters which don't scratch up indoor floors or dirt paths in parks.

There are also three-wheel rollators which are smaller than four-wheel models, and can make more precise turns. These are often lighter and can be easier to maneuver. Some people prefer three-wheeled walkers because they are easier to balance and less likely to fall over while walking up or down stairs.

The majority of models come with dual braking systems that function similar to the brakes of bicycles. They are easy to engage or disengage, and provide more control when braking and while sitting. Some models have brakes that lock so you can sit comfortably and not be concerned about the walker rolling.

Another important factor to consider when choosing the best walker with a seat is the capacity for weight. Most standard walkers can support 250-350 pounds, but if you need a heavier-duty model there are bariatric models that can hold up to 500 pounds.

Rollators are more common than walkers. They usually come with seating that allows the user to stop and rest when they need to while walking. They also have hand-operated brakes as well as the front wheels are typically swivel to maneuver in tight spaces. A majority of them are foldable to make them easier to transport in a vehicle or bus.

The casters on the rollator are typically larger than those on a walker with two wheels. They also have a tread that is designed to prevent the device from skidding or marking indoor surfaces. Larger wheels make it more comfortable to use outdoors and on rough or uneven terrain. The most commonly used wheel size for outdoor use is 6" however, there are models with 8" wheels.
